Gestalt counselling, developed by Fritz Perls, is a person-centered approach that focuses on the individual's present experience and the relationship between the client and therapist. The goal of Gestalt counselling is to help clients become more aware of their th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, and to take responsibility for their own lives.

This comprehensive guide will provide practitioners with the essential knowledge and skills necessary to develop their practice in Gestalt counselling. We will explore the core principles of Gestalt counselling, the therapeutic techniques used, and the applications of Gestalt counselling in various settings.

The core principles of Gestalt counselling are based on the concept of holism, which views the individual as a whole being, rather than as a collection of separate parts. Gestalt counsellors believe that the individual's present experience is the most important factor in therapy, and that the past and future are only relevant insofar as they affect the present.

Other key principles of Gestalt counselling include:

  • Phenomenology: Gestalt counsellors focus on the client's subjective experience of the world, rather than on objective reality.
  • Contact: Gestalt counsellors believe that contact between the client and therapist is essential for growth and change.
  • Responsibility: Gestalt counsellors believe that clients are responsible for their own lives and choices.
  • Creativity: Gestalt counsellors encourage clients to use their creativity to find new ways to solve problems.

Gestalt counsellors use a variety of therapeutic techniques to help clients become more aware of their thoughts, feelings, and behaviors. These techniques include:

  • Empty chair work: Gestalt counsellors often have clients interact with an empty chair, to help them explore their relationships with others.
  • Dreamwork: Gestalt counsellors believe that dreams can provide insight into the client's unconscious mind.
  • Bodywork: Gestalt counsellors use bodywork to help clients connect with their physical sensations.
  • Art therapy: Gestalt counsellors sometimes use art therapy to help clients express their feelings and thoughts.

Gestalt counselling can be used to treat a wide range of psychological issues, including:

  • Anxiety
  • Depression
  • Relationship problems
  • Trauma
  • Addiction
